The Dracénie is strategically located in the heart of Provence, between the Verdon and the Mediterranean. 83% of this territory is farmland, forest or agricultural land. Provencal villages to discover,
The 23 villages that make up the Dracénie are all unique, and well worth a visit. From the perched villages to those on the Verdon, on the Argens plain and in the hills. These charming villages invite you to stroll under the southern sun and relax!
